#c98b7f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c98b7f is composed of 78.8% red, 54.5% green and 49.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.8% magenta, 36.8%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 9.7 degrees, a saturation of 40.7% and a lightness of 64.3%. #c98b7f color hex could be obtained by blending #fffffe with #931700.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#c98b7f color description : Slightly desaturated red.

#c98b7f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c98b7f has RGB values of R:201, G:139, B:127 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.31, Y:0.37,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 13208447.

Shades and Tints of #c98b7f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0504 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#c98b7f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a6a3a2 is the less saturated color, while #fa6a4e is the most saturated one.
